Output 891dcf52bf04945585f83a4c354e659ef040ef25773cea485bfa0cf1c1426ca6:12

value
27500893
script pubkey
OP_0 OP_PUSHBYTES_20 c31225f3c7f777b7e684df6de2a89382c162d877
address
bc1qcvfztu787amm0e5ymak792ynstqk9krhv35rg9
transaction
891dcf52bf04945585f83a4c354e659ef040ef25773cea485bfa0cf1c1426ca6